ABSTRACT

Construction Industry is the 2nd largest industry in India next to


agriculture. It makes a significant contribution to the national economy
and provides employment to large number of people. The use of various
new technologies and deployment of project management strategies has
made it possible to undertake projects of mega scale. It is the only
unorganized sector where work is carried out on daily basis and majority
of work force involved is mobile, illiterate, orphans and deserted by the
society and very often the projects were carried out in extreme
environmental conditions prone to accidents and health when compared
to other areas.

Inspite of the progress made in reducing accidents the management


should focus to increase the efforts to further minimize occupational
injuries and deaths which may affect the availability of manpower and
also some financial losses to both workers and management which
indirectly incurs heavy expenses resulting out of accidents, decreased
production, damage to the machinery, poor quality of products, excessive
waste of working hours, project duration and overall project cost. In order
to reduce and eliminate construction accidents the various researches
have explored techniques implemented by different construction agencies
to reduce the number of accidents and its consequences.

Over the last few years an alternative reasoning and problem


solving method known as Case Based Reasoning (CBR) has attracted
more and more attention which solves new problems by adopting
previously successful solution to similar problems in construction projects.
An attempt has been made to identify the major causes of accidents that
affect safety in construction industry and also to suggest a methodology
to prevent and reduce the accidents using CBR methodology.

Previous accidents that have took place in the recent years were
studied by preserving the case studies with the causes of accidents
leading to severe major and minor accidents with their impact on the
construction project.

Using some past cases, the CBR methodology has been applied to
prevent accidents in a project under construction. Required safety
measures and precautions have been suggested that would prevent the
accidents in a project. The study under CBR provides new direction for
applying it to other construction management problems. The major
strength of the case based approach system is that the guidance in the
form of relevant previous cases is provided in almost every instance.
